Mrs. Charles (Elmira) E. Preston, age 82, of 318 E. Circle Drive, Whitelaw,
died Monday morning, June 8, 2009, at River's Bend Health and Rehabilitation
Center, Manitowoc.
Elmira was born Dec. 2, 1926, the daughter of the late Henry and Esther
(Reimer) Behnke. She married Charles Preston on Nov. 3, 1948, at St.
Augustine's Catholic Church in Reifs Mills. Elmira worked at Tecumseh,
Paragon Electric and at Branch River Country Club and Fox Hills Resort as
a waitress. She was a member of St. Michael Catholic Church and St. Michael
Christian Mothers of Whitelaw. Elmira enjoyed gardening and sewing quilts.
